Output 95ec8136af81a3e72f7d90af34bca5543a5857ae9200394f111afabc6a30d004:7

value
4552675
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 981ee01439f9210c1eba27a47f4147be4c3411a7 OP_EQUALVERIFY OP_CHECKSIG
address
1EsLhQuu4FrgAY2NyK1dRkLYWLg5JrrTdt
transaction
95ec8136af81a3e72f7d90af34bca5543a5857ae9200394f111afabc6a30d004
confirmations
264543
spent
true